U.S. Atty. Roy Hayes said in Detroit that he will look into reports that General Motors Corp. employees rolled back odometers on test-driven vehicles at a plant in Pontiac, Mich. Meanwhile, executives of GM’s Truck & Bus Group, which oversees the plant, said they were conducting an internal investigation to verify weekend reports in the Oakland Press, a Pontiac newspaper. The report follows the June 24 indictment of Chrysler Corp. in St. Louis on fraud charges of testing vehicles with disconnected odometers.
